可以使用super()函数来实现不重复构造函数的情况下继承父类属性。例如:父类:export class ParentComponent { name: st...
在Angular组件库中使用服务通常需要将其注入到组件构造函数中。然而,在将服务注入到每个组件中可能会导致代码冗长和重复。因此,最好的解决方法是使用依赖注入来管...
确认你在使用组件库的时候已经安装了所有的依赖库。例如,如果你使用的是ngx-bootstrap组件库,那么你需要安装依赖库,包括bootstrap、ngx-bo...
当在Angular中遇到“选择器[你的组件名称]无效”的错误时,通常是由于组件命名限制造成的。Angular组件的选择器必须遵循一些命名规则,否则会导致该错误。...
在Angular中,可以通过在组件级别的服务中注入另一个组件级别的服务来实现组件之间的依赖注入。以下是一个示例:创建两个组件级别的服务文件:service1.s...
在Angular中,可以使用组件继承来实现父组件的生命周期钩子的执行。以下是一个使用组件继承的示例代码:父组件(parent.component.ts):imp...
可以使用AngularJS的“angular.element”将组件降级为AngularJS指令,这样就可以在AngularJS应用中进行渲染。以下是示例代码:...
在Angular中,组件可以看到在同一文件中定义的接口。如果您在组件中无法访问接口,可能是由于以下几个原因:确保接口的定义在组件之前:在同一文件中,接口的定义必...
解决方法一:使用Angular Material组件库和NGRX存储首先,确保已经安装了Angular CLI和Angular Material,可以使用以下命...
这种错误通常是由于在父组件中未定义某个字段而导致的。解决此问题的方法是在父组件中声明该字段。以下示例展示了如何在父组件中定义一个名为“foo”的字段,并在子组件...
使用服务(Service)来共享数据在一个服务中定义一个属性,用来存储要共享的数据。然后在需要访问这个数据的组件中注入该服务。这样,在任何组件中修改服务中的数据...
在Angular中,组件之间的交互可以通过在组件之间发送和接收事件来实现。为了实现焦点和失去焦点的输出事件,我们可以使用Angular的@Output装饰器和E...
在Angular中,组件之间可以通过继承来共享代码和功能。下面是一个示例,演示如何在Angular中进行组件继承和继承订阅。首先,我们创建一个基类组件,命名为B...
在 'ExpenseEntryComponent' 类型中声明 'expenseEntry' 属性。代码示例:在 'ExpenseEntryComponent'...
在Angular中,组件模板继承是通过使用Angular的继承功能和ng-content指令来实现的。这个过程中,一个组件可以继承另一个组件的模板,并插入子组件...
要在Angular组件加载后实现自动完成操作,可以使用Angular Material中提供的Autocomplete组件。首先,安装Angular Mater...
当我们在一个Angular组件中使用可观察对象时,有时候当可观察对象发生变化时,组件模板并不会自动更新来响应这些变化。这可能是由于以下原因之一导致的:可能未正确...
在Angular应用程序中,组件路由是一种用于导航到不同组件的机制。然而,使用组件路由可能会面临一些挑战。下面是一些解决这些挑战的方法,并包含了一些代码示例。路...
在Angular中,组件之间可以通过服务进行数据和方法共享,但是在跨组件时需要注意服务提供商的注册方式。以下是一个示例:首先,创建一个名为“shared.ser...
在Angular应用程序中,组件的SCSS样式表可以通过将其与组件的.ts文件放在同一个文件夹中来单独管理,这种约定被称为组件局部SCSS约定。默认情况下,An...